Shielded Sensor Cable

APPLICATION

Smaller cables providing easier handling and space savings.

Compatible with wire-handling equipment used in harness shops.

Compatible with over-molding processes and materials used in sensor assembly.

STANDARDS

Basic design to EN50264

FIRE PERFORMANCE

Flame Retardance (Single vertical wire or cable test) IEC 60332-1-2; EN 60332-1-2
Reduced Fire Propagation (Vertically-mounted bundled wires & cables test) IEC 60332-3-24; EN 60332-3-24
Halogen Free IEC 60754-1; EN 50267-2-1
No Corrosive Gas Emission IEC 60754-2; EN 50267-2-2
Minimum Smoke Emission IEC 61034-2; EN 61034-2

CABLE CONSTRUCTION

Conductor : Tinned Copper /Bare Copper.

Insulation : Cross-linked PVDF over XLPE.

Screen : Aluminum/PET Wrap+ Drain Wire.

Sheath : Cross-linked Fluoroelastomer or Cross-linked Modified Polyolefin.

Outer Sheath Option : UV resistance, hydrocarbon resistance, oil resistance, anti-rodent and anti-termite properties can be offered as option.

COLOUR CODE

Insulation Colour : Blue,Brown,Black,White,Green(Other colours can be offered upon request).

Sheath Colour : Black (Other colours can be offered upon request).

PHYSICAL AND THERMAL PROPERTIES

Operating temperature : -55°C - 200°C.

Short-term operating temperature :

240 hours @ 175°C (Cross-linked modified polyolefin sheath);

160 hours @ 250°C (Cross-linked modified polyolefin sheath);

6 hours @ 300°C (Cross-linked fluoroelastomer sheath);

Cold bend :

–40°C (Cross-linked modified polyolefin sheath);

–25°C (Cross-linked fluoroelastomer sheath).

Flammability :

70s (Cross-linked modified polyolefin sheath);

30s (Cross-linked fluoroelastomer sheath).

Abrasion (ISO 6722) :

> 500 cycles (Cross-linked modified polyolefin sheath);

> 1000 cycles (Cross-linked fluoroelastomer sheath).

Fluid resistance : As per ISO6722:2011 (E) Media groups 1 & 2.

Bending radius : 10xOD during installation; 5xOD fixed installed.

CONSTRUCTION PARAMETERS

Conductor Sensor Cable
No.of Cores × Cross Section Class of Conductor Min. Overall Diameter Max. Overall Diameter Weight
mm² mm mm kg/km
2×0.35 2 3.2 3.6 20.0
3×0.35 2 3.4 3.8 24.8
2×0.50 2 3.4 3.8 24.8
3×0.50 2 3.6 4.0 31.0
2×0.75 2 3.8 4.2 33.0
3×0.75 2 4.1 4.5 41.7
2×1.0 2 4.1 4.5 40.7
3×1.0 2 4.4 4.8 51.8
